ABSTRACT: Nexus thinking, in the form of integrating water security with agriculture, energy and climate concerns, is normatively argued to help better transition societies towards greener economies and the wider goal of sustainable development. Yet several issues emerge from the current debate surrounding this concept, namely the extent to which such conceptualisations are genuinely novel, whether they complement (or are replacing) existing environmental governance approaches and how – if deemed normatively desirable – the nexus can be enhanced in national contexts. This paper therefore reviews the burgeoning nexus literature to determine some common indicative criteria before examining its implementation in practice vis-à-vis more established integrated water resources management (IWRM) models. Evidence from two divergent national contexts, the UK and Bangladesh, suggests that the nexus has not usurped IWRM, while integration between water, energy, climate and agricultural policy objectives is generally limited. Scope for greater merging of nexus thinking within IWRM is then discussed.

ABSTRACT: This paper explores the role of politics in water management, in particular, comparing groundwater management in Yemen and Ethiopia. It tries to understand the precise meaning of the often-quoted term 'political will' in these different contexts and compares the autocratic and oligarchic system in Yemen with the dominant party 'developmental state' in Ethiopia. The links between these political systems and the institutional domain are described as well as the actual management of groundwater on the ground. Whereas the Ethiopian state is characterised by the use of hard power and soft ideational power, the system in Yemen relies at most on soft negotiating power. There is a strong link between the political system, the positioning of different parties and access to power, the role of central and local governments, the propensity to plan and vision, the effectiveness of government organisations, the extent of corruption, the influence of informal governance mechanisms, the scope for private initiative and the political interest in groundwater management and development in general. More important than political will per se is political capacity – the ability to implement and regulate.

ABSTRACT: Despite a history of participatory policies, Thailand’s Royal Irrigation Department (RID) has had little success in developing water user organisations (WUOs) capable of facilitating cooperation between farmers and the irrigation agency. Even so, pockets of participation exist. What can explain these rare successes? What policy lessons can they provide? Comparing nine WUOs, I identify factors that contribute to the emergence of relatively successful groups. Most importantly, I show that successful WUOs are contingent on the actions of local irrigation officials. These findings emphasise the important role of street-level bureaucrats in implementing participatory policies. The incentive structures provided by the RID, though, deter most officials from sincerely collaborating and cooperating with farmers. Thus experts and policy-makers interested in promoting participatory resource management should focus more attention on shaping incentives for local officials to engage meaningfully with farmers.

ABSTRACT: Groundwater is the main source of agricultural and municipal water and contributes 70% of total water use in Yemen. All aquifers are depleting at a very high rate owing to combined effects of a host of socioeconomic, institutional and climate-change factors. The government policy on diesel subsidy was largely believed to be one of the significant factors which stimulated large-scale pumping of water for irrigating water-intensive cash crops such as qat, fruits, and vegetables. A rapid field assessment was conducted between June and December 2011 in six different regions of the country to analyse the impacts of the severe diesel crisis that accompanied the political turmoil of 2011 on groundwater use and agriculture. The study highlighted winners and losers in the process of adapting to diesel shortage and high diesel prices. Farmers’ responses differed according to their social status, financial resources, and farming systems. Poorly endowed households partially or completely abandoned agriculture. Others abandoned farming of irrigated cereals and fodder, but practised deficit irrigation of fruits and vegetables, thus halving the consumption of diesel. Crop yields dropped by 40-60% in all surveyed regions. The intra-governorate transport halt due to the sharp increase in transport cost caused prices at the farm gate to drop. Only those farmers who could absorb increases in diesel prices due to high return:cost ratios, higher drought tolerance, stable prices (qat), and access to alternative sources of water could cope with the diesel crisis.

ABSTRACT: In sub-Saharan Africa, motor pump irrigation is at an earlier stage than in Asia but is growing rapidly in many countries. The focus of both policy and research in Africa to date has been on facilitating supply chains to make pumps available at a reasonable price. In Africa, pump irrigation is mainly based on two sources: shallow groundwater aquifers and small streams and rivers. Both usually have limited and variable yields. We present a case study from Ethiopia where pump irrigation based on small rivers and streams is expanding rapidly, and draw parallels to experiences in Asia and other African countries. We show that while farmers understand the social nature of community-managed irrigation, they share with policymakers a narrow understanding of pump irrigation as being primarily 'technical'. They perceive pumps as liberating them from the 'social' limitations of traditional communal irrigation. However, the rapid expansion of pump irrigation is leading to increasing competition and conflict over the limited water resource. We analyse the wider implications for Africa of this blindness to the social dimension of pump irrigation and offer suggestions on future policy and applied research to address the problem before it becomes a widespread crisis.

ABSTRACT: This article advances a critique of the UN Economic and Social Commission for West Asia’s (ESCWA’s) representation of the Jordan River Basin, as contained in its recently published Inventory of Shared Water Resources in Western Asia. We argue that ESCWA’s representation of the Jordan Basin is marked by serious technical errors and a systematic bias in favour of one riparian, Israel, and against the Jordan River’s four Arab riparians. We demonstrate this in relation to ESCWA’s account of the political geography of the Jordan River Basin, which foregrounds Israel and its perspectives and narratives; in relation to hydrology, where Israel’s contribution to the basin is overstated, whilst that of Arab riparians is understated; and in relation to development and abstraction, where Israel’s transformation and use of the basin are underplayed, while Arab impacts are exaggerated. Taken together, this bundle of misrepresentations conveys the impression that it is Israel which is the main contributor to the Jordan River Basin, Arab riparians its chief exploiters. This impression is, we argue, not just false but also surprising, given that the Inventory is in the name of an organisation of Arab states. The evidence discussed here provides a striking illustration of how hegemonic hydro-political narratives are reproduced, including by actors other than basin hegemons themselves.

ABSTRACT: Public access to government-maintained water and climate data in the three major co-riparian countries of the Ganges Basin – Nepal, India and Bangladesh – has been either inadequately granted or formally restricted. This paper examines the effects of newly enacted Right to Information (RTI) laws in these three countries to assess changes in the information access regimes as they relate to hydrological data. We find that neither the RTI laws nor the internal and external demand for increased transparency in governments have affected access to information regimes on water at a fundamental level. In India, the RTI laws have not eased public access to data on its transboundary rivers including in the Ganges Basin and in Nepal and Bangladesh, while data can be legally accessed using RTI laws, the administrative procedures for such an access are not developed enough to make a tangible difference on the ground. We then discuss the implications of our findings on the continuing impasse on regional collaboration on water in South Asia and point to rapid advancements in technology as an emerging pathway to greater data democracy.

ABSTRACT: The Chilean system of tradable water rights and water markets has been well known and controversial in international water policy circles since the 1990s. Chile’s 1981 Water Code is a textbook example of neo-liberalism, with strong private property rights and weak government regulation, and the market in water rights has been the dominant theme in debates about Chilean water policy, both nationally and internationally. The Water Code was somewhat reformed in 2005 after over 13 years of political debate. In this paper I review the issues in water policy and politics in Chile during the decade since that reform. What does the ongoing Chilean experience tell us about water privatisation, markets, and commoditisation? Water conflicts have become the essential issue in Chile, rather than water markets. In the past decade conflicts among multiple water users have deepened and widened in many parts of the country, involving river basins and groundwater aquifers. The institutional framework for governing these water conflicts has worked poorly, for a variety of reasons, and the conflicts have become a serious national political problem. I review the evolving political and policy debates in Chile, including the current government’s proposal in 2014 for a new and stronger reform of the Water Code. In short, the critical problem of the Chilean water model is the lack of institutional capacity for governance or integrated water resources management, and the problem has worsened as water conflicts have become closely linked to conflicts in the energy and environmental sectors.

ABSTRACT: Despite significant financial, ecological and social trade-offs, China has moved forward with constructing and operationalising the world’s largest interbasin water transfer project to date, the South-North Water Transfer Project (SNWTP). While it is fundamentally linked to broader political-economic goals within the context of China’s post-Mao development agenda, the SNWTP is frequently discussed in apolitical terms. Based on extensive discourse analysis and interviews with government officials across North China, I argue that the Chinese government is using "discourses of deflection" to present the project as politically neutral in order to serve its ultimate goal of maintaining the high economic growth rates that underpin its continued legitimacy. These discourses, which replace concerns with human-exacerbated water stress with naturalised narratives about water scarcity and the ecological benefits of water transfer, serve to deflect attention away from anthropogenic sources of water stress in the North China Plain and serve as apolitical justifications for pursuing a short-term supply-side approach rather than the more politically challenging and longer-term course of dealing with the underlying drivers of water stress in the region.

ABSTRACT: There is growing evidence that rural and peri-urban households depend on water not only for basic domestic needs but also for a wide variety of livelihood activities. In recognition of this reality, an alternative approach to water service planning, known as multiple-use water services (MUS), has emerged to design water services around householdsʼ multiple water needs. The benefits of MUS are diverse and include improved health, food security, income generation, and women’s empowerment. A common argument put forth by WASH sector professionals in favour of upgrading existing water systems is that productive water uses allow for income generation that, in turn, enhances the ability to pay for services. However, there has been limited rigorous research to assess whether the additional income generated from productive use activities justifies water service upgrading costs. This paper describes an income-cost (I-C) analysis based on survey data and EPANET models for 47 domestic-plus water systems in rural Senegal to assess whether the theoretical financial benefits to households from additional piped-water-based productive activities would be greater than the estimated system upgrade costs. The paper provides a transparent methodology for performing an I-C analysis. We find that the potential incremental income earned by upgrading the existing domestic-plus systems to provide intermediate-level MUS would be equivalent to the funds needed to recover the system upgrade costs in just over one year. Thus, hypothetically, water could pay for water. A sensitivity analysis shows that even with a 55% reduction in household income earned per cubic meter of water, the incremental income is still greater than the upgrade costs over a ten-year period for the majority of the systems.
